class InterconnectAttachment extends Collection (View source)

Properties

protected $collection_key
bool $adminEnabled
string $bandwidth
string[] $candidateIpv6Subnets
string[] $candidateSubnets
string $cloudRouterIpAddress
string $cloudRouterIpv6Address
string $cloudRouterIpv6InterfaceId
protected $configurationConstraintsType
protected $configurationConstraintsDataType
string $creationTimestamp
string $customerRouterIpAddress
string $customerRouterIpv6Address
string $customerRouterIpv6InterfaceId
int $dataplaneVersion
string $description
string $edgeAvailabilityDomain
string $encryption
string $googleReferenceId
string $id
string $interconnect
string[] $ipsecInternalAddresses
string $kind
string $labelFingerprint
string[] $labels
int $mtu
string $name
string $operationalStatus
string $pairingKey
string $partnerAsn
protected $partnerMetadataType
protected $partnerMetadataDataType
protected $privateInterconnectInfoType
protected $privateInterconnectInfoDataType
string $region
string $remoteService
string $router
bool $satisfiesPzs
$selfLink
string $stackType
string $state
int $subnetLength
string $type
int $vlanTag8021q

Methods

setAdminEnabled($adminEnabled)

No description

bool
getAdminEnabled()

No description

setBandwidth($bandwidth)

No description

string
getBandwidth()

No description

setCandidateIpv6Subnets($candidateIpv6Subnets)

No description

string[]
getCandidateIpv6Subnets()

No description

setCandidateSubnets($candidateSubnets)

No description

string[]
getCandidateSubnets()

No description

setCloudRouterIpAddress($cloudRouterIpAddress)

No description

string
getCloudRouterIpAddress()

No description

setCloudRouterIpv6Address($cloudRouterIpv6Address)

No description

string
getCloudRouterIpv6Address()

No description

setCloudRouterIpv6InterfaceId($cloudRouterIpv6InterfaceId)

No description

string
setCreationTimestamp($creationTimestamp)

No description

string
getCreationTimestamp()

No description

setCustomerRouterIpAddress($customerRouterIpAddress)

No description

string
getCustomerRouterIpAddress()

No description

setCustomerRouterIpv6Address($customerRouterIpv6Address)

No description

string
getCustomerRouterIpv6Address()

No description

setCustomerRouterIpv6InterfaceId($customerRouterIpv6InterfaceId)

No description

string
setDataplaneVersion($dataplaneVersion)

No description

int
getDataplaneVersion()

No description

setDescription($description)

No description

string
getDescription()

No description

setEdgeAvailabilityDomain($edgeAvailabilityDomain)

No description

string
getEdgeAvailabilityDomain()

No description

setEncryption($encryption)

No description

string
getEncryption()

No description

setGoogleReferenceId($googleReferenceId)

No description

string
getGoogleReferenceId()

No description

setId($id)

No description

string
getId()

No description

setInterconnect($interconnect)

No description

string
getInterconnect()

No description

setIpsecInternalAddresses($ipsecInternalAddresses)

No description

string[]
getIpsecInternalAddresses()

No description

setKind($kind)

No description

string
getKind()

No description

setLabelFingerprint($labelFingerprint)

No description

string
getLabelFingerprint()

No description

setLabels($labels)

No description

string[]
getLabels()

No description

setMtu($mtu)

No description

int
getMtu()

No description

setName($name)

No description

string
getName()

No description

setOperationalStatus($operationalStatus)

No description

string
getOperationalStatus()

No description

setPairingKey($pairingKey)

No description

string
getPairingKey()

No description

setPartnerAsn($partnerAsn)

No description

string
getPartnerAsn()

No description

setPrivateInterconnectInfo(InterconnectAttachmentPrivateInfo $privateInterconnectInfo)

No description

setRegion($region)

No description

string
getRegion()

No description

setRemoteService($remoteService)

No description

string
getRemoteService()

No description

setRouter($router)

No description

string
getRouter()

No description

setSatisfiesPzs($satisfiesPzs)

No description

bool
getSatisfiesPzs()

No description

setSelfLink($selfLink)

No description

string
getSelfLink()

No description

setStackType($stackType)

No description

string
getStackType()

No description

setState($state)

No description

string
getState()

No description

setSubnetLength($subnetLength)

No description

int
getSubnetLength()

No description

setType($type)

No description

string
getType()

No description

setVlanTag8021q($vlanTag8021q)

No description

int
getVlanTag8021q()

No description

Details

setAdminEnabled($adminEnabled)

No description

Parameters

$adminEnabled

bool getAdminEnabled()

No description

Return Value

bool

setBandwidth($bandwidth)

No description

Parameters

$bandwidth

string getBandwidth()

No description

Return Value

string

setCandidateIpv6Subnets($candidateIpv6Subnets)

No description

Parameters

$candidateIpv6Subnets

string[] getCandidateIpv6Subnets()

No description

Return Value

string[]

setCandidateSubnets($candidateSubnets)

No description

Parameters

$candidateSubnets

string[] getCandidateSubnets()

No description

Return Value

string[]

setCloudRouterIpAddress($cloudRouterIpAddress)

No description

Parameters

$cloudRouterIpAddress

string getCloudRouterIpAddress()

No description

Return Value

string

setCloudRouterIpv6Address($cloudRouterIpv6Address)

No description

Parameters

$cloudRouterIpv6Address

string getCloudRouterIpv6Address()

No description

Return Value

string

setCloudRouterIpv6InterfaceId($cloudRouterIpv6InterfaceId)

No description

Parameters

$cloudRouterIpv6InterfaceId

string getCloudRouterIpv6InterfaceId()

No description

Return Value

string

setConfigurationConstraints(InterconnectAttachmentConfigurationConstraints $configurationConstraints)

No description

Parameters

InterconnectAttachmentConfigurationConstraints $configurationConstraints

setCreationTimestamp($creationTimestamp)

No description

Parameters

$creationTimestamp

string getCreationTimestamp()

No description

Return Value

string

setCustomerRouterIpAddress($customerRouterIpAddress)

No description

Parameters

$customerRouterIpAddress

string getCustomerRouterIpAddress()

No description

Return Value

string

setCustomerRouterIpv6Address($customerRouterIpv6Address)

No description

Parameters

$customerRouterIpv6Address

string getCustomerRouterIpv6Address()

No description

Return Value

string

setCustomerRouterIpv6InterfaceId($customerRouterIpv6InterfaceId)

No description

Parameters

$customerRouterIpv6InterfaceId

string getCustomerRouterIpv6InterfaceId()

No description

Return Value

string

setDataplaneVersion($dataplaneVersion)

No description

Parameters

$dataplaneVersion

int getDataplaneVersion()

No description

Return Value

int

setDescription($description)

No description

Parameters

$description

string getDescription()

No description

Return Value

string

setEdgeAvailabilityDomain($edgeAvailabilityDomain)

No description

Parameters

$edgeAvailabilityDomain

string getEdgeAvailabilityDomain()

No description

Return Value

string

setEncryption($encryption)

No description

Parameters

$encryption

string getEncryption()

No description

Return Value

string

setGoogleReferenceId($googleReferenceId)

No description

Parameters

$googleReferenceId

string getGoogleReferenceId()

No description

Return Value

string

setId($id)

No description

Parameters

$id

string getId()

No description

Return Value

string

setInterconnect($interconnect)

No description

Parameters

$interconnect

string getInterconnect()

No description

Return Value

string

setIpsecInternalAddresses($ipsecInternalAddresses)

No description

Parameters

$ipsecInternalAddresses

string[] getIpsecInternalAddresses()

No description

Return Value

string[]

setKind($kind)

No description

Parameters

$kind

string getKind()

No description

Return Value

string

setLabelFingerprint($labelFingerprint)

No description

Parameters

$labelFingerprint

string getLabelFingerprint()

No description

Return Value

string

setLabels($labels)

No description

Parameters

$labels

string[] getLabels()

No description

Return Value

string[]

setMtu($mtu)

No description

Parameters

$mtu

int getMtu()

No description

Return Value

int

setName($name)

No description

Parameters

$name

string getName()

No description

Return Value

string

setOperationalStatus($operationalStatus)

No description

Parameters

$operationalStatus

string getOperationalStatus()

No description

Return Value

string

setPairingKey($pairingKey)

No description

Parameters

$pairingKey

string getPairingKey()

No description

Return Value

string

setPartnerAsn($partnerAsn)

No description

Parameters

$partnerAsn

string getPartnerAsn()

No description

Return Value

string

setPartnerMetadata(InterconnectAttachmentPartnerMetadata $partnerMetadata)

No description

Parameters

InterconnectAttachmentPartnerMetadata $partnerMetadata

setPrivateInterconnectInfo(InterconnectAttachmentPrivateInfo $privateInterconnectInfo)

No description

Parameters

InterconnectAttachmentPrivateInfo $privateInterconnectInfo

InterconnectAttachmentPrivateInfo getPrivateInterconnectInfo()

No description

setRegion($region)

No description

Parameters

$region

string getRegion()

No description

Return Value

string

setRemoteService($remoteService)

No description

Parameters

$remoteService

string getRemoteService()

No description

Return Value

string

setRouter($router)

No description

Parameters

$router

string getRouter()

No description

Return Value

string

setSatisfiesPzs($satisfiesPzs)

No description

Parameters

$satisfiesPzs

bool getSatisfiesPzs()

No description

Return Value

bool

No description

Parameters

$selfLink

No description

Return Value

string

setStackType($stackType)

No description

Parameters

$stackType

string getStackType()

No description

Return Value

string

setState($state)

No description

Parameters

$state

string getState()

No description

Return Value

string

setSubnetLength($subnetLength)

No description

Parameters

$subnetLength

int getSubnetLength()

No description

Return Value

int

setType($type)

No description

Parameters

$type

string getType()

No description

Return Value

string

setVlanTag8021q($vlanTag8021q)

No description

Parameters

$vlanTag8021q

int getVlanTag8021q()

No description

Return Value

int